A shortcoming is that added metals can undergo leaching, leading to catalyst deactivation and secondary contamination of the treated water. In the present study, CWPO of phenol aqueous solutions was investigated in the presence of five commercial ACs without added metals yet containing different extents of iron impurities resulting from their industrial preparation procedures (ROX 0.8, RX 3-Extra, C-Gran and PK 0.25-1 from Cabot Norit and HYDRAFFIN AS 12\/450 from Degussa). Application of as-received ROX 0.8 leads to the best compromise between removals of phenol (79%) and total organic carbon (TOC; 50%) and iron leaching (0.22 mg L\u22121). In-house-modified ROX 0.8 materials, obtained by thermal treatment under inert atmosphere followed by activation under oxidative atmosphere, were also tested. The activity of ROX 0.8 oxidized at 673 K (ROXN673) was the highest among these materials (92% and 57% of phenol and TOC removals, respectively) and with iron leaching (0.67 mg L\u22121) well below the limits established by European regulations for discharge of treated waters.
